Output 7ddf5933a75dda9d0427d758d96c9b577ba79fac60b8e6324f60a99a3dab2d94:119

value
28712
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47adfe3c77f9d16ed1004b2a2c2c652f0ece0e46 OP_EQUAL
address
38E2LR8s9ViUVZ85ogJjMWxcbpBG5Uw2d2
transaction
7ddf5933a75dda9d0427d758d96c9b577ba79fac60b8e6324f60a99a3dab2d94
spent
true